Fatma Othman is the richest beggar in the world

She lived a wicked but miserable life, but she left her with wealth for her family, which no one in her family knew and begged and gathered in the streets of the Lebanese capital Beirut.
She slept in an old car in the horticultural area of ​​Beirut and considered it a house for years. Fatima Mohammed Othman, the daughter of Ayn al-Zahab in Akkar, who was physically disabled, was carrying a card confirming her death Tuesday in Uzi-Basta.
The news of the death of the famous beggar, the Lebanese interest in social media, increased fame after it turned out that the deceased (53 years) in possession of wealth.
According to witnesses, the amount of 5 million Lebanese pounds in cash, or more than 3300 dollars hidden between their personal property, as well as bank books, and another bank account worth more than one million dollars, according to the pictures sent on the sites.
The news of her death sparked controversy on social networking sites. While many have argued that many beggars practice fraud to double their wealth, some have found this news confusing and difficult. It is impossible for women to collect all the money and stay on the streets.
